Frequently Asked Questions

Is Cincinnati, OH or Scranton, PA safer?

Scranton is safer with a higher safety score by 16 points. Cincinnati, OH has a safety score of 55/100 while Scranton, PA has 71/100, based on FBI Uniform Crime Report data.

What is the violent crime rate in Cincinnati, OH vs Scranton, PA?

Cincinnati, OH has a violent crime rate of 845.6 per 100,000 residents, while Scranton, PA has 281.4 per 100,000. Lower rates indicate safer communities. The national average is approximately 380 per 100,000.

What is the property crime rate in Cincinnati, OH vs Scranton, PA?

Cincinnati, OH has a property crime rate of 3829.3 per 100,000, compared to 1345.1 per 100,000 in Scranton, PA. Property crimes include burglary, theft, and motor vehicle theft.

How are CrimeSafe safety scores calculated?

Safety scores range from 0-100, combining violent crime rates, property crime rates, and population data from the FBI UCR. Higher scores mean safer cities. Grades: A (80+), B (65-79), C (50-64), D (40-49), F (below 40).
